Destinee Rhamy lucked out having this private attorney court appointed to her two year case after the PD's office last minute trial delay two weeks ago

 


Homicide suspect Destinee Rhamy's case was on today for trial setting and confirmation of counsel. Ms. Andrea Sullivan was appointed to represent Rhamy. Deputy District Attorney Roger Rees is the prosecutor for this case. Trial setting on 5/6.

In my March 27, post, I reported that Rhamy was most likely to get a private attorney. Ms. Sullivan is her third attorney.
